Maintaining Optimal Humidity Percentages

Achieving even home comfort frequently hinges on precisely managing humidity. High humidity can foster mildew growth and create a damp feeling, while very minimal humidity typically leads to arid epidermis and irritated breathing tracts. The advised range is generally within 30% and 50%, but this could differ according to individual likes and the region. Employing a dehumidifier during damp seasons, or a moisture adding device in arid situations, can effectively resolve these issues. Frequently monitoring humidity using a moisture meter is crucial for preventative moisture control.

Grasping Relative Dampness: A Usable Guide

Relative moisture is a my explanation idea that often gets tossed around, but what does it actually suggest? It doesn't measure the level of water in the air directly, but rather the ratio of water vapor present compared to the maximum amount the air could hold at a given heat. Think of it this way: warmer air can hold more water vapor than cooler air. Consequently, a relatively low relative moisture on a warm day might still feel quite uncomfortable, while a higher reading on a cold day could feel quite dry. Tracking relative humidity is crucial for everything from preserving fragile materials to ensuring optimal coziness in your home. You can readily measure it with a hygrometer, accessible at most supply stores.

Minimizing Moisture Formation

Dealing with moisture can be a common headache, especially in colder environments. Thankfully, several simple strategies exist to reduce its formation. Improving airflow is often the first step; opening panels regularly, or installing ventilation fans in kitchens, can drastically lower moisture levels. Furthermore, ensuring proper insulation on walls helps maintain temperatures and reduce the difference between indoor and outdoor air, as a result limiting condensation. You might also consider using a dehumidifier in affected areas. Regularly cleaning glass also stops presence of dampness.
